¿Los navegadores analizan javascript en cada página cargada?

¿Los navegadores (IE y Firefox) analizan los archivos javascript vinculados cada vez que se actualiza la página?

Pueden almacenar en caché los archivos, así que supongo que no intentarán descargarlos cada vez, pero como cada página está esencialmente separada, espero que destruyan cualquier código antiguo y lo vuelvan a analizar.

Esto es ineficiente, aunque es perfectamente comprensible, pero me pregunto si los navegadores modernos son lo suficientemente inteligentes como para evitar el paso de análisis dentro de los sitios. Estoy pensando en casos en los que un sitio utiliza una biblioteca de javascript, como ExtJS o jQuery, etc.

Respuestas a la pregunta(6)

Su respuesta a la pregunta